Michael Schwartzbach new member of the Danish Natural Science Research Council

Friday 29. of June 2007

Helge Sander, the Danish Minister for Science, Technology and Innovation has appointed new members to the Danish Natural Science Research Council (DNSRC). Michael Schwartzbach is one of them.

The DNSRC provides research-related advice within the natural sciences, computer science and mathematics both upon application or upon the initiative of the Council.
